Ingredients You Will Need
To create this high protein and flavorful bake you will need to gather these simple items from your grocery store or kitchen pantry.
-
Two pounds of boneless and skinless chicken breasts or thick white fish fillets
-
Three t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il
-
Two large fresh lemons for juice and slicing
-
Two tablespoons of dry ranch seasoning mix
-
One tablespoon of coarse ground black pepper
-
One teaspoon of garlic powder for extra depth
-
One half teaspoon of sea salt
-
One half cup of chicken broth or water to keep it moist
-
One large head of fresh broccoli cut into small florets
-
One red bell pepper sliced into thin strips
-
Fresh parsley chopped for a beautiful garnish at the end
Step by Step Method
Following these easy steps will help you create a perfect lemon pepper ranch bake every single time you cook.
First you need to preheat your oven to four hundred degrees Fahrenheit. This high temperature is important because it helps the protein cook quickly while staying juicy and it gives the vegetables a nice roasted texture.
Take a large glass or ceramic baking dish and lightly coat the bottom with a small amount of olive oil or a healthy cooking spray. This prevents the chicken or fish from sticking to the pan while it bakes.
Wash your chicken or fish under cold water and pat it very dry with paper towels. Removing the extra moisture from the surface is a key secret to getting the seasoning to stick properly and helping the edges get a little bit brown.
In a small mixing bowl combine the olive oil and the juice of one lemon along with the ranch seasoning and black pepper and garlic powder and salt. Stir this mixture until it becomes a thick and flavorful paste.
Place your protein into the baking dish and pour the seasoning mixture over the top. Use your hands or a brush to make sure every piece is completely covered in the lemon ranch paste. If you have extra time you can let this sit for fifteen minutes to marinate but it is not strictly necessary.
Arrange the broccoli florets and the red bell pepper strips around the pieces of protein in the baking dish. If the pan feels too crowded you can use a larger tray to ensure the heat can move around each piece of food.
Drizzle a little bit of extra olive oil over the vegetables and sprinkle them with a tiny bit more salt and pepper. Pour the chicken broth or water into the bottom of the dish being careful not to wash the seasoning off the meat.
Slice the second lemon into thin rounds and place them directly on top of the protein. As these bake the lemon oils will seep into the meat and add a very fresh and bright aroma to the whole dish.
Place the baking dish in the center of the oven and bake for twenty five to thirty minutes. If you are using chicken you should check that the internal temperature reaches one hundred sixty five degrees. If you are using fish it should easily flake with a fork when it is done.
Remove the dish from the oven and let it rest for five minutes. This resting period allows the juices to settle back into the meat so it stays tender when you cut into it.
Sprinkle the fresh chopped parsley over the top for a pop of green color and a fresh finish. Serve it warm directly from the dish and make sure to spoon some of the extra lemon ranch juice from the bottom of the pan over each serving.

Extra Tips for Better Taste
If you want to make this bake even more delicious you can try adding some red chili flakes to the seasoning mix for a spicy kick that goes great with the lemon. You could also sprinkle a little bit of parmesan cheese over the top during the last five minutes of baking to get a salty and crispy crust. For a more earthy flavor you can add some fresh sprigs of rosemary or thyme to the pan while it cooks. If you prefer your vegetables to be very soft you can put them in the oven ten minutes before you add the protein. Another great tip is to use a mix of different colored bell peppers to make the dish look even more appetizing and increase the variety of nutrients in your meal. Always try to use fresh lemons instead of bottled juice because the flavor of fresh citrus is much more vibrant and has a better aroma.

Nutrition Details
The table below shows the estimated nutrition for one serving of this bake assuming the recipe is divided into four large portions.
| Nutrient Category | Amount Per Serving |
| Calories | Three hundred forty calories |
| Total Fat | Twelve grams |
| Saturated Fat | Two grams |
| Cholesterol | Ninety five milligrams |
| Sodium | Five hundred eighty milligrams |
| Total Carbohydrates | Eight grams |
| Dietary Fiber | Three grams |
| Sugars | Two grams |
| Protein | Forty eight grams |
| Vitamin C | Seventy percent of daily value |
